The study aimed to determine the effect of heart failure with preserved ejection fraction and heart failure with reduced ejection fraction on patients with diabetes. In a particular group of patients from PARAGON-HF, several health measurements were taken, including body mass index, structural enrolment of the heart disease, and blood pressure, including systolic and diastolic blood pressure. Another health measurement that was taken was the rate of glomerulus filtration. There was a random assignment to the treatment of various patients using valsartan. Enrollment occurred between 7 and 8 years ago. Patients offered written consent to allow the process of enrollment to occur. The patients recorded a varying diagnosis of diabetes. Glycated hemoglobin was also another important measure for the patients. International Diabetes Expert committee grouped the patients into three groups based on their history of diabetic infection. Regular patients who indicated a usual health condition were less than 6%, while those implied prediabetic conditions were between 6% and 6.4%. Above 6.5% were patients who recorded a diabetic disease. Several cases arose of some patients dying due to kidney failure. Nonetheless, some patients improved their condition and therefore surpassed the state. Baseline characteristics depended on measures of standard variation, including mean, mode, and median.  

Approximately 2300 patients were found to have a diabetic infection. In total, there were about 4700 patients who were diagnosed. The number of patients who had diabetes constituted about 49%. Out of the 2300 patients, approximately 2060 patients had an informed diagnosis, while the rest were not informed before the diagnosis. Therefore, 7% of the patients had undiagnosed diabetes, while about 12% had diagnosed diabetes. The number of prediabetes patients was about 874, which accounted for about 6% of the total number of patients. Only about 1500 patients recorded a normal condition. This accounted for less than 6% of the total number of patients. More patients with diabetes were young, and most of them were male rather than female. Patients with diabetes registered a high body mass index. Such patients had already contracted high blood pressure and atherothrombotic disease initially. Other common conditions usually associated with diabetes include anemia and sleeping sickness. Patients with diabetes usually showed more significant breathing difficulties than prediabetes patients. The patients who registered normal health conditions did not have any difficulty breathing. However, studies indicated that such patients could also be susceptible to diabetes. 

The study focused on patients with diabetes, and sampling focused on specific patients rather than random selection. Therefore, the selected participants are only a tiny reflection of patients with HFpEF and HFrEF. Generally, diabetes and prediabetes have a significant impact on HFpEF. Patients with diabetes and prediabetes have a worse clinical status and a high risk of developing cardiovascular diseases. Glucose lowering is essential in reducing the effects of diabetes and prediabetes on various patients.
